What is a Red Dot Sight?

A red dot sight (sometimes referred to as an RDS) is an optical device that attaches to your firearm and gives you a better acquisition of your target. Unlike traditional scopes, the red dot sight does not require any magnification. Instead, it uses a single illuminated reticle (the “dot”), which appears on the lens when viewed through the optics. This gives you a clear view of your intended target without having to strain your eyes trying to focus on something far away.

Setting Up Your Red Dot Sight

Once you have chosen your firearm and mounted the red dot sight onto it properly, setting up your new device is relatively straightforward.

Most red dots come with some form of adjustable windage (side-to-side) and elevation (up-and-down) knobs that will allow you to make minor adjustments, depending on where your bullet lands in relation to where you were aiming. All you need is a good set of tools, such as Allen keys or screwdrivers — whatever works best for your particular model of red dot sight.

Why Should You Use It?

Using a red dot sight makes shooting easier, especially when aiming at moving targets or in low-light conditions. The bright reticle helps acquire targets quickly with minimal effort. Simply point and fire.

Additionally, since there is no need for magnification, you can use your red dot sight with both eyes open. This can give you greater situational awareness compared with traditional scopes or iron sights.

Finally, many models are incredibly lightweight so they won’t add too much extra heft to your firearm setup.
